View from the train, Garsdale Railway Station
Garsdale Railway Station, at one time known as Hawes Junction, photographed from a north bound Diesel Multiple Unit shortly to stop en route to Carlisle. In steam days this was a very busy location but at the time of my visit the line was under threat of closure, happily this was not carried out and trains still stop here albeit without the forward view of former days.
